In rehab, there are two different types of 30-day treatment:

Partial Hospitalization

In this type of program, the treatment is more intense. Due to the full time schedule the patient follows and the hospital setting, it is almost inpatient treatment. However, it is not “inpatient” because partial hospitalization does not require the patient stay over night. In fact, the patient returns home each night and travels back to get treatment daily. Normally, this treatment lasts 2-3 weeks. The services each center offers include:

  • ✔ Detox Services
  • ✔ Medical Treatment
  • ✔ Cognitive Behavioral Therapy

Short-Term Residential

These programs require the person to stay overnight. Likewise, the community setting allows them to interact with other people recovering. These programs include all of the previous services as well as:

  • ✔ Contingency Management Interventions
  • ✔ Matrix Model
  • ✔ 12- Step Programs

The Steps of 30-Day Programs and Beyond

There are 4 necessary steps to each program. The completion of every step needs to happen to give the patient the bast chance of sober living. In addition, each step has its own place on the path to recovery. The medical experts will do these steps in the correct order to bring about the best results. Properly exercising each step is very important to the experts and specialists helping the patient. Every step is important to do as thoroughly as possible. These steps are evaluation, detoxification, therapy, and aftercare.

1. EVALUATION

This first step is important because of the need for precise examination. The development of every individual treatment plan occurs during this step. Thus explaining the need for accuracy. Furthermore, when developing this plan, it is critical to consider the substance, length of time, and severity of the person’s addiction. After considering this, the medical specialists will create a personal custom plan for the patient. During the process, they will check for co occurring disorders as well. Frequently, multiple mental illnesses can exist in one patient at the same time. This increases the difficulty of reaching recovery. However, it is always possible.

2. DETOXIFICATION

Once the medical experts decide on an individual treatment program for the patient, the next step is detox. Detox is very important when it comes to breaking the patients physical dependency to the substance. Overall, the main goal is to manage withdrawal safely and effectively. This means separating the person from their substance of choice. Also, it involves making sure the patient is safe during the withdrawal period. Sometimes, substances like alcohol can have harsh withdrawal symptoms. Other times, drugs like stimulants have only moderate symptoms for withdrawal. It is never a good idea to try the detox procedure alone.

3. THERAPY

The next step in the rehab process is attending therapy. Using psychotherapy as the centerpiece, rehab centers give patients a chance to discover who they are. Additionally, group counseling, behavioral training, and other therapeutic activities give them a chance to learn about themselves. Identifying triggers for substance usage is the number one goal in this step. Along with this, learning how to overcome and avoid these triggers is very important. Specifically, cognitive behavioral therapy gives the patient tools to help them overcome moments of temptation. Also, social coaching can help patients learn how to find support in others.

4. AFTERCARE

The previous steps include assessment, breaking the physical bond, and learning how to live without the substance. This may sound like everything someone would need. However, this is not the case. Living with an addiction requires daily maintenance. This is why rehab centers put together aftercare treatment plans. These plans prevent the patient from relapsing and reestablishing addiction. Therapists and addiction specialists teach patients the tools they need in therapy. Nevertheless, aftercare plans help guide the patient use these tools accordingly.
